OVH Cloud OVH Cloud

tester le format d'une cellule

5 réponses
Avatar
denis le breton
Bonjour ! chers amis du jour
Et hop une nouvelle question, elle est pour qui ? hein ! qui la veut ? qui
la prend ?

je répète la question, euh non je ne l'ai pas en core posée, alors c'est
parti.
dans ma colonne A j'ai une suite de nombres (composés de chiffres).
et puis patatrac tout d'un coup au détour d'une cellule j'ai une valeur
composé de chiffres et de une ou plusieurs lettres
exemple
56874
96842
957a6
56874

8v4r2

et comme j'applique tout une série de traitement en fonction des doublons ou
des vides ...
je voudrais tester le contenu type ou plutôt le format de ma cellule pour
lui appliquer un traitement particulier (par exemple l'effacer, ou la
remettre à 0)
or je ne trouve pas de Range("A1").Format pour le récuperer le tester et lui
appliquer ce que je veux
S clair ?
Merci
Denis

5 réponses

Avatar
Ellimac
Bonjour,

If Isnumeric(ActiveCell) Then
ou
If Not Isnumeric(ActiveCell) Then

Camille

-----Message d'origine-----
Bonjour ! chers amis du jour
Et hop une nouvelle question, elle est pour qui ? hein !
qui la veut ? qui

la prend ?

je répète la question, euh non je ne l'ai pas en core
posée, alors c'est

parti.
dans ma colonne A j'ai une suite de nombres (composés de
chiffres).

et puis patatrac tout d'un coup au détour d'une cellule
j'ai une valeur

composé de chiffres et de une ou plusieurs lettres
exemple
56874
96842
957a6
56874

8v4r2

et comme j'applique tout une série de traitement en
fonction des doublons ou

des vides ...
je voudrais tester le contenu type ou plutôt le format
de ma cellule pour

lui appliquer un traitement particulier (par exemple
l'effacer, ou la

remettre à 0)
or je ne trouve pas de Range("A1").Format pour le
récuperer le tester et lui

appliquer ce que je veux
S clair ?
Merci
Denis

.



Avatar
Denis
Bonjour,
c'est peut-être NumberFormat que tu cherches

Denis
-----Message d'origine-----
Bonjour ! chers amis du jour
Et hop une nouvelle question, elle est pour qui ? hein !
qui la veut ? qui

la prend ?

je répète la question, euh non je ne l'ai pas en core
posée, alors c'est

parti.
dans ma colonne A j'ai une suite de nombres (composés de
chiffres).

et puis patatrac tout d'un coup au détour d'une cellule
j'ai une valeur

composé de chiffres et de une ou plusieurs lettres
exemple
56874
96842
957a6
56874

8v4r2

et comme j'applique tout une série de traitement en
fonction des doublons ou

des vides ...
je voudrais tester le contenu type ou plutôt le format de
ma cellule pour

lui appliquer un traitement particulier (par exemple
l'effacer, ou la

remettre à 0)
or je ne trouve pas de Range("A1").Format pour le
récuperer le tester et lui

appliquer ce que je veux
S clair ?
Merci
Denis

.



Avatar
Lolote
Salut Ellimac,
Bravo pour tes réponses, cela fait 3 ou 4 x que tu me passes devant.
J'ai a peine eu le temps de lire la question que déjà tu y as répondu.
Bravo pour ta rapidité.

@+ lolote


"Ellimac" a écrit dans le message de
news: 7ec101c52893$759faef0$
Bonjour,

If Isnumeric(ActiveCell) Then
ou
If Not Isnumeric(ActiveCell) Then

Camille

-----Message d'origine-----
Bonjour ! chers amis du jour
Et hop une nouvelle question, elle est pour qui ? hein !
qui la veut ? qui

la prend ?

je répète la question, euh non je ne l'ai pas en core
posée, alors c'est

parti.
dans ma colonne A j'ai une suite de nombres (composés de
chiffres).

et puis patatrac tout d'un coup au détour d'une cellule
j'ai une valeur

composé de chiffres et de une ou plusieurs lettres
exemple
56874
96842
957a6
56874

8v4r2

et comme j'applique tout une série de traitement en
fonction des doublons ou

des vides ...
je voudrais tester le contenu type ou plutôt le format
de ma cellule pour

lui appliquer un traitement particulier (par exemple
l'effacer, ou la

remettre à 0)
or je ne trouve pas de Range("A1").Format pour le
récuperer le tester et lui

appliquer ce que je veux
S clair ?
Merci
Denis

.



Avatar
denis le breton
Impec
entre temps un peu plus bourrin j'avais trouvé
range(....)selection
if selection > 99999# then
...
endif

Merci
Denis


Bonjour,

If Isnumeric(ActiveCell) Then
ou
If Not Isnumeric(ActiveCell) Then

Camille

-----Message d'origine-----
Bonjour ! chers amis du jour
Et hop une nouvelle question, elle est pour qui ? hein !
qui la veut ? qui

la prend ?

je répète la question, euh non je ne l'ai pas en core
posée, alors c'est

parti.
dans ma colonne A j'ai une suite de nombres (composés de
chiffres).

et puis patatrac tout d'un coup au détour d'une cellule
j'ai une valeur

composé de chiffres et de une ou plusieurs lettres
exemple
56874
96842
957a6
56874

8v4r2

et comme j'applique tout une série de traitement en
fonction des doublons ou

des vides ...
je voudrais tester le contenu type ou plutôt le format
de ma cellule pour

lui appliquer un traitement particulier (par exemple
l'effacer, ou la

remettre à 0)
or je ne trouve pas de Range("A1").Format pour le
récuperer le tester et lui

appliquer ce que je veux
S clair ?
Merci
Denis

.






Avatar
denis le breton
C pa grav Lolote
tu l'auras la prochaîne fois
garde confiance
et puis si tu veux je te garderai la prochaine
A+
et merci
Denis


Salut Ellimac,
Bravo pour tes réponses, cela fait 3 ou 4 x que tu me passes devant.
J'ai a peine eu le temps de lire la question que déjà tu y as répondu.
Bravo pour ta rapidité.

@+ lolote


"Ellimac" a écrit dans le message de
news: 7ec101c52893$759faef0$
Bonjour,

If Isnumeric(ActiveCell) Then
ou
If Not Isnumeric(ActiveCell) Then

Camille

-----Message d'origine-----
Bonjour ! chers amis du jour
Et hop une nouvelle question, elle est pour qui ? hein !
qui la veut ? qui

la prend ?

je répète la question, euh non je ne l'ai pas en core
posée, alors c'est

parti.
dans ma colonne A j'ai une suite de nombres (composés de
chiffres).

et puis patatrac tout d'un coup au détour d'une cellule
j'ai une valeur

composé de chiffres et de une ou plusieurs lettres
exemple
56874
96842
957a6
56874

8v4r2

et comme j'applique tout une série de traitement en
fonction des doublons ou

des vides ...
je voudrais tester le contenu type ou plutôt le format
de ma cellule pour

lui appliquer un traitement particulier (par exemple
l'effacer, ou la

remettre à 0)
or je ne trouve pas de Range("A1").Format pour le
récuperer le tester et lui

appliquer ce que je veux
S clair ?
Merci
Denis

.